Networking and replication: actor replication, property replication, net relevancy, dormancy. Actions: - set_replicates: Enable actor replication. Params: blueprintPath, replicates? - set_property_replicated: Mark variable as replicated. Params: blueprintPath, propertyName, replicated?, replicationCondition?, repNotify? - configure_net_frequency: Set update frequency. Params: blueprintPath, netUpdateFrequency?, minNetUpdateFrequency? - set_dormancy: Set net dormancy. Params: blueprintPath, dormancy - set_net_load_on_client: Control client loading. Params: blueprintPath, loadOnClient? - set_always_relevant: Always network relevant. Params: blueprintPath, alwaysRelevant? - set_only_relevant_to_owner: Only relevant to owner. Params: blueprintPath, onlyRelevantToOwner? - configure_cull_distance: Net cull distance. Params: blueprintPath, netCullDistanceSquared? - set_priority: Net priority. Params: blueprintPath, netPriority? - set_replicate_movement: Replicate movement. Params: blueprintPath, replicateMovement? - get_info: Get networking info. Params: blueprintPath. Yes. Add a rate_limit block to the networking r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for networking.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
